About the Role

We are looking for an experienced and driven Outbound SDR Team Lead to lead and scale our Sales Development function. In this role, you will own the performance, development, and execution of our Israeli outbound SDR team, ensuring consistent pipeline generation through high-quality automated lead flow and meeting qualification.

You will play a critical role in building a predictable outbound motion, coaching SDRs to excellence, and partnering closely with Sales and Operations to drive revenue growth.

What You'll Do

  • Lead, manage, and develop a team of outbound SDRs to consistently meet and exceed meeting targets.
  • Own the outbound prospecting strategy, including persona targeting, sequencing, messaging, and qualification standards. Working closely with the Operations team to make it structured and scalable.
  • Monitor and analyze SDR performance metrics (activity, conversion rates, pipeline contribution) and drive continuous improvement.
  • Provide ongoing coaching, feedback, and training to improve outbound effectiveness, objection handling, and discovery skills.
  • Run regular team meetings, 1:1s, and performance reviews to drive accountability and growth.
  • Ensure accurate tracking and reporting in CRM and sales engagement tools.
  • Implement best practices, tools, and processes to scale outbound efforts efficiently.
  • Stay up to date on outbound sales trends, methodologies, and competitive landscape.

Requirements

  • Proven experience as an Outbound SDR manager, with a strong track record of meeting or exceeding targets. Preferably in a B2B SaaS environment.
  • Strong understanding of outbound sales development, prospecting techniques, and qualification frameworks.
  • Data-driven mindset with the ability to analyze performance and translate insights into action.
  • Excellent communication, coaching, and leadership skills.
  • Hands-on experience with CRM systems and sales engagement tools such as Salesforce, Salesloft/Outreach and Nooks.
  • Highly organized, results-oriented, and comfortable working in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Willingness to align working hours with US business hours and th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Marketing, or a related field — preferred but not required
